Separate Disbursements.
Alms and charitable donations of the King and
his family, fo. 47. L.1,166 14 6
Necessaries for the King’s household, travelling
expenses, ambassadors, messengers to Court
of Rome, wages of King’s servants _not_ on
the Marshall’s roll, &c. (Observ. on W. A.
fo. viii.) 3,338 19 3
Expenses of messengers and others, despatched
on King’s business, fo. 303. 87 11 1
Falconers, huntsmen, &c. fo. 309 77 6 11½
Allowance to bannerets, knights, clerks, and
other servants of the King’s household for
their winter and summer robes, fo. 331. 714 3 4
Expenses of sundry furnishings for the Royal
household, including separate expenses of the
Queen and her household, amounting to
L.3668, 2s. 9d., and Chancellor’s fee, amounting
to L.581, 9s. 9d. fo. 360. 15,575 18 5½
“The account then states the payments contained
in this book to amount to L.53,178 15 0
“To which are added the expenses of the household
contained in a separate account, amounting
to L.10,969 16 0½
---------------
And “the whole of the national expenditure,
within this department, during one entire
year,” is stated at L.64,105 0 5
==============
It is added, “The account is corrected and
approved by the comptroller in every page;
but the balance is not struck. If we take,
however, the sum told of the money received,
which amounted to L.58,155 16 2
And deduct it from the money paid, we shall
find a balance due to the accountant, amounting
to 5,949 4 3”
